Lakmé Fashion Week Summer/Resort 2018 Day 1: Half Full Curve Brought Sexy Goddess Fashion To 6degree Studio

It was a show devoted to the sexy, voluptuous, goddesses of the world. The Half Full Curve collection was displayed at 6Degree Studio on Day 1 of Lakmé Fashion Week Summer/Resort 2018.

The ‘Half Full Curve’ label, is the brainchild of Rixi Bhatia (of Quirkbox fame) and her sister Tinka. It has been created for the stylish Plus Size women who have been ignored by the fashion fraternity for long.

The label aims women to flaunt their curves and that is what the collection was all about. Aimed at real women of varied sizes and shapes, the ensembles inspired by nature were devoted to Luxury Resort wear for the coming season.

The show opened with a lovely poem that spoke about promoting body positivity and encouraging women to be their own kind of beautiful.

The fabrics were a mix of pure georgette, sheer Chanderi, Dupion silk and splashed with bouquets of flowers in thread work, sequins, beadwork and lots of appliqués. The emphasis was on textures with a profusion of wildflower motifs, delicate embroidery and pastel hues being the leitmotif of the collection.

The silhouettes were vintage, wearable and chic that would allow the fashion-forward women to choose apparel from dawn to dusk. Popular shapes were the draped lungi style skirts worn with jackets and the cowl kurtas teamed with multi-coloured covers. Metallic came to the forefront in the shape of dhotis and palazzos.

Designers Rixi and Tinka encouraged women to be body positive and confident in their skin. It was a collection that proudly announced “My Body My Choice” which will make the wearer the stylish Diva she is.

The youngest model on the ramp was a perky, 19-year-old, while the eldest was a mature lady who will turn 81 in two months.

The show stopper was the very elegant fashionista, Anjana Sharma who glided down the catwalk in a kimono style cover and sleek gown.
